Misconception: Therapy Is Only for Extreme Mental Disorders



Many individuals believe that therapy is only necessary for those grappling with serious mental illnesses, however that's merely not true.

In reality, therapy can profit anybody, no matter their mental wellness standing. You may feel overwhelmed by day-to-day stress factors, connection issues, or even simply a general sense of dissatisfaction with life.

These sensations don't call for a severe diagnosis to look for aid. Therapy provides a safe space for you to discover your thoughts and feelings, develop coping strategies, and gain important insights right into your actions.

It has to do with individual growth and boosting your lifestyle. By addressing issues early, you can avoid them from rising into even more substantial problems later on.

Everybody deserves assistance, and treatment can be that support.

Misconception: Medicine Is the Only Option



While medication can be a fundamental part of therapy for some people, it definitely isn't the only solution readily available. Lots of people discover success with various restorative approaches, such as c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T), mindfulness practices, or way of living adjustments.

These techniques can help you establish dealing strategies, boost emotional policy, and address underlying issues. Additionally, assistance from buddies, family, or support groups can give valuable inspiration and understanding.

Taking part in regular workout, keeping a well balanced diet regimen, and exercising great sleep hygiene can additionally considerably enhance your mental well-being.

It's important to remember that an all natural strategy, integrating drug when necessary with treatment and way of life modifications, typically causes the most effective outcomes. Discover what jobs best for you and do not wait to look for varied choices.
